USB Flash Drive Materials and Construction

Advanced materials and technology combined in the building of sandisk usb pro guarantees performance and durability. Usually, a flash drive's outer shell is made of metal or plastic, protecting against physical wear and tear. A tiny printed circuit board (PCB) inside holds the flash memory chip and controller, two essential data storage and management components. Some sandisk usb pro are enclosed in strong and waterproof materials, making them appropriate for usage in demanding conditions. Can tablets and smartphones use USB flash drives?

 

Many sandisk usb pro drives work with tablets and smartphones, especially those marked OTG (On-The-Go). These devices may connect directly to mobile devices via USB ports, allowing for simple data transfer without needing a computer.

What to do if a computer does not identify my USB Flash Drive?

Should a sandisk usb pro not show up on the computer, check first that the USB port is operating properly.  Restart the computer or attempt to connect the drive to another USB port. Should the problem continue, look for driver upgrades or think about running data recovery software on the drive holding vital data.
